SALAM AIR chooses APG as its online GSA in Kazakhstan

All, news

To establish direct air connectivity with the world’s popular destinations, Oman’s value-for-money airline SalamAir has announced the introduction of a direct flight between Almaty and Muscat, the capital city of Oman, with weekly flights beginning from July 1, 2023.

SalamAir has appointed APG as its online General Sales Agent (GSA) in Kazakhstan. Under the agreement APG will be providing the airline with sales development and wide-ranging marketing activities, as well as reservation and ticketing services. 

With the high demand for unique tourist destinations such as Almaty, SalamAir looks forward to welcoming customers onboard these new flights soon. Air tickets for this route and other flights of SalamAir can be purchased on the official website of the airline, www.salamair.com, mobile app, call center, as well as accredited agencies of the air carrier.

​Currently, SalamAir is utilizing Airbus A320neo aircraft and Airbus A321neo, making them the 1st Omani carrier to utilize these highly rated single-aisle aircraft. This also opens new travel possibilities across the region and the world. The partnership with ATS Network further strengthens Salam Air’s dedication to providing seamless travel experiences for customers here in Kazakhstan.

ABOUT SALAM AIR 
 www.salamair.com

SalamAir commenced its commercial operations in 2017, intending to set new standards in the aviation industry in Oman. SalamAir meets the country’s increasing demand for affordable travel options and aims to generate further opportunities for employment and business creation in various Oman sectors. In six years, SalamAir has achieved growth in its operations and expanded its region’s reach. SalamAir was awarded Oman’s Most Trusted Brand 2021 and The Youngest Fleet in Asia for 2021 and 2022 by Ch-Aviation. It operates six A320neo, five A321neo, and one Airbus A321 freighter.

SalamAir flies to domestic destinations, including Muscat, Salalah, Suhar, Duqm, and Masirah, and international destinations to Dubai, Doha, Riyadh, Rize, Jeddah, Dammam, Madinah, Kuwait, Bahrain, Beirut, Sarajevo, Istanbul, Trabzon, Bursa, Baku, Almaty, Colombo, Kathmandu, Bangkok, Phuket, Kuala Lumpur, Prague, Shiraz, Tehran, Mashhad, Alexandria, Khartoum, Multan, Sialkot, Karachi, Dhaka, Chattogram, Jaipur, Trivandrum, and Lucknow. SalamAir flies directly from Suhar to Shiraz, Salalah , Calicut, and  Trabzon, and Salalah to Calicut and Bahrain.

APG IET partners with Blue Ribbon Bags to offer delayed luggage service to 275 ticket holders

All, news

We’re thrilled to announce that APG has signed an exclusive partnership agreement with Blue Ribbon Bags to provide baggage protection services for all passengers traveling with 275 tickets. The partnership aims to offer peace of mind to passengers in case of lost or delayed baggage incidents. 

​Starting May 1, 2023, all tickets issued in GDS on 275 will automatically include Blue Ribbon Bags’ protection services. In the event of lost or delayed baggage, passengers can file a claim on the dedicated APG-IET Blue Ribbon Bags website (https://apgiet.blueribbonbags.com/) to initiate the tracking and expedited delivery of their bags.

Blue Ribbon Bags’ services include tracking and expediting the return of delayed airport baggage for the first 96 hours from when the destination flight lands. Customers will receive constant updates every time there is a change to the status of their mishandled bag. This innovative solution will provide a hassle-free travel experience for all passengers.

The new partnership reflects APG’s commitment to enhancing the customer experience and ensuring that passengers have a seamless journey from start to finish. “We understand the frustration that lost or delayed baggage can cause, and we are delighted to partner with Blue Ribbon Bags to offer an easy and reliable solution to our passengers,” said Ophelie Cherdrong, Executive Product Director for APG IET.

“Our service provides air travelers with confidence that if their checked-in baggage does not arrive at the destination airport, we will coordinate and expedite the swift return. Our clients should be able to enjoy their holiday or focus on their work trip while we locate and expedite the baggage,” stated CD Lazear, SVP Global Sales of Blue Ribbon Bags.

Blue Ribbon Bags has a proven track record of delivering excellent customer service and helping passengers reunite with their belongings quickly. The new partnership between APG and Blue Ribbon Bags is a testament to the two companies’ shared values of putting the customer first and ensuring a smooth and enjoyable travel experience.

WESTJET prepares for Tokyo operations and appoints APG as its online GSA in Japan

All, news

WestJet, a Canadian carrier headquartered in Calgary, Alberta has appointed APG as its online General Sales Agent (GSA) in Japan. Under the agreement APG will be providing the airline with sales development and wide-ranging marketing activities, as well as reservation and ticketing services.

Commencing April 30th, 2023, WestJet will inaugurate its first transpacific service with the launch of the Calgary, Canada (YYC) to Narita, Tokyo (NRT) route. The route will be operated with a Boeing 787-9 Dreamliner scheduled for the summer IATA season as follows:
Route: Calgary, Canada (YYC) – Narita, Tokyo (NRT)
Frequency: 3 times a week, from 30APR to 28OCT (summer schedule)
WS80 YYC-NRT 15:00-16:05+1 (Wed/Fri), 15:10-16:15+1 (Sun)
WS81 NRT-YYC 18:15-12:15 (Mon/Sat), 18:30-12:30 (Thu)

With this route travelers flying between Canada and Japan will have the advantage of the only non-stop connection between the Alberta province and Asia, providing them with a more convenient and seamless travel experience.

“With our new service to Tokyo Narita starting the end of April, we are thrilled to work with APG as our representative for ticket sales and promotions in Japan.  Their innovative approach and well-established relationships with the Japanese travel trade will contribute greatly to our successful entry into the Japanese market,” said Charles Crowder, Vice-President, Sales and Distribution at WestJet.

“We are delighted to be further expanding our longstanding and valued partnership with WestJet as they launch the excellent WestJet service into Asia. Our team in Japan have been working very closely with WestJet to ensure a successful launch and are very much looking forward to welcoming the first flight into Tokyo” adds Richard Burgess, President, APG Network.

ABOUT WestJet:
www.westjet.com
In 27 years of serving Canadians, WestJet has cut airfares in half and increased the flying population in Canada to more than 50 per cent. WestJet launched in 1996 with three aircraft, 250 employees and five destinations, growing over the years to more than 180 aircraft, 14,000 employees and more than 110 destinations in 24 countries.

CYPRUS AIRWAYS appoints APG for online GSA services to the UAE and Czech Republic

All, news

Cyprus Airways, national flag carrier of Cyprus, based at Larnaca International Airport, has chosen APG as its online General Sales Agent (GSA) in the UAE and Czech Republic. Under the agreement APG will be supporting the launch of Cyprus Airways’ new services from Dubai to Larnaca and from Prague to Larnaca, providing the airline with sales development and wide-ranging marketing activities to enhance the airlines presence in the markets, as well as reservation and ticketing services.

As part of its international expansion, Cyprus Airways launched the new route between Dubai and Larnaca on 29th of March 2023. The service will operate twice weekly in April increasing to three times weekly from 1st May 2023.  The twice weekly service to Prague is starting on 3rd of May 2023. Both routes will be operated with an Airbus A320 offering 180 Economy Class seats.

Cyprus Airways is strategically positioned to connect Europe with Asia, the Middle East and Africa. Its international network currently includes Tel Aviv, Beirut, Rome, Paris, Yerevan, Athens and several popular destinations in Greece during the summer season. Summer 2023 schedule also includes Milan, Zurich, Basel and Cairo.

“Cyprus Airways is thrilled to partner with APG as our General Sales Agent in the UAE and Czech Republic for our new services from Dubai and Prague to Larnaca. Our expansion into these markets is a testament to our commitment to growth and offering our customers new and exciting travel options. With APG’s expertise, we are confident that we will enhance our presence in these markets and provide our customers with exceptional service.“ Commented Mr Paul Sies  – CEO, Cyprus Airways.

“APG is delighted to be extending its valued partnership with Cyprus Airways into further markets as the airline not only adds important flight options to Cyprus but also very attractive connections between the Middle East, Africa and Europe. We very much look forward to working with Cyprus Airways to successfully launch the new routes and support the airline’s excellent strategic post-pandemic growth” commented Richard Burgess, President APG Network.

ABOUT CYPRUS AIRWAYS:
www.cyprusairways.com
Cyprus Airways, Cyprus’s flag-carrier, resumed operations in 2016. The airline operates two Airbus A320 aircraft fleet which are currently operating on a eighteen-scheduled destination network.

Winter destinations include Athens, Beirut, Tel Aviv, Yerevan, Paris and Rome. Additionally, summer destinations include Basel, Zurich, Milan-Bergamo, Athens, Santorini, Skiathos, Rhodes, Heraklion, Preveza, and Cairo.

In July 2018, Cyprus Airways has successfully passed the International Air Transport Association (IATA) Operational Safety Audit (IOSA), one of the highest standards in the world for airline operational safety. In October 2018, the company became a member of the International Air Transport Association (IATA).

TAP AIR PORTUGAL chooses APG as its GSA in 18 markets across Europe, Africa, Asia and Australia

All, news

TAP AIR PORTUGAL, the flag carrier airline of Portugal, has chosen APG Network to expand its reach across 18 markets in Europe, Africa, Asia and Australia. APG will provide comprehensive sales and marketing activities as well as ticketing and reservation services, enabling the airline to strengthen its position in these key markets.

With its headquarters based at Lisbon Airport, TAP AIR PORTUGAL has a long-standing reputation for excellence in the aviation industry. The airline operates a fleet of modern aircraft, connecting Portugal to major cities across Europe, Africa, Asia and the Americas.

“​TAP selected APG as GSA to represent her and develop its sales in 18 countries in the world. In this joint force, TAP is aiming to improve presence in the markets and grow its revenue”, said Justin Jovignot, Director Commercial Strategy & Distribution “TAP is flying directly to some of the markets where it has appointed APG as GSA, but the focus is also on offline markets, where TAP is still not flying to and where growth potential is a key element for future business development”. 

“We are honored that TAP AIR PORTUGAL has chosen APG as their partner in a wide range of markets across multiple continents,
” said Richard Burgess, President of APG Network. “We look forward to working closely with the TAP AIR PORTUGAL team to develop and implement effective sales and marketing strategies in these markets that will increase brand awareness and lead to solid revenue growth.“

ABOUT TAP Air Portugal:
www.flytap.com

TAP Air Portugal is a 78-year-old national airline committed to providing exceptional service and safety to passengers. As a member of the Star Alliance network, TAP operates flights to 90 destinations in 36 countries. Its modern fleet includes the latest Airbus aircraft, while its cabin interiors offer maximum comfort and state-of-the-art entertainment. TAP is also dedicated to sustainability, reducing its carbon footprint with biofuels and more efficient procedures. The airline takes pride in promoting Portuguese culture and traditions, from its cuisine to inflight magazine features. TAP Air Portugal is a world-class airline that continues to grow while maintaining its strong Portuguese heritage.

Air Mauritius Appoints APG as GSA

All, news

Air Mauritius is pleased to announce the appointment of APG as its GSA Sales and Marketing in Austria, Belgium, Cyprus, Greece, Luxemburg, The Netherlands, Portugal, and Spain. APG is a global firm with more than a hundred offices operating in over one hundred and seventy countries.

This partnership represents a significant opportunity for Air Mauritius to strengthen its global presence, expand sales in critical markets, and generate additional tourism from these markets. APG has the essential resources and proficiency to effectively enhance Air Mauritius’ international representation, marketing, and communication capabilities.

APG currently represents Air Mauritius in significant markets, namely the USA, Canada, Italy, Switzerland, and Germany. This strategic appointment is set to play a key role in facilitating the airline’s expansion efforts, particularly with the advent of new operations in Europe.

As from October 2023, Air Mauritius will commence operations of two weekly flights to Geneva while also increasing its frequencies to London with a daily flight to London Gatwick Airport starting on October 29, 2023.

The CEO of Air Mauritius, Mr Krešimir Kučko stated that, ” Aligned with our objective to aid Mauritius in attaining its target of 1.4 million visitors by the end of this year, we view this initiative as an optimal means of augmenting our network of distinguished sales agents by collaborating with APG, which we believe will bolster Air Mauritius’ sales.“

The CEO of APG Inc, Ms Sandrine de Saint Sauveur added: “We are delighted to enhance our partnership with Air Mauritius to deliver the best services.”

AIR BALTIC plans new European routes and extends its partnership with APG to Romania, Moldova and Turkey

All, news

airBaltic, the flag carrier of Latvia, with its Head Office based at Riga International Airport, has appointed APG as its online GSA in Romania, Moldova and Turkey. Under the agreement APG will be providing the airline with wide ranging sales activities, marketing support, reservation and ticketing services to support the launch of airBaltic’s new routes to Bucharest and Istanbul.

airBaltic will operate 4 weekly flights from Riga to Istanbul starting April 1, 2023. While Riga to Bucharest, Otopeni is planned from May 1, 2023 with 3 weekly frequencies. All flights will be operated by the most modern and environmentally friendly Airbus A220-300 aircraft.

airBaltic, currently serves over 70 routes with direct flights out of capitals of the Baltic States – Riga (Latvia), Vilnius (Lithuania) and Tallinn (Estonia) to multiple destinations spanning Europe, Scandinavia, CIS and the Middle East.

Martin Gauss, airBaltic President and CEO said: “This upcoming summer season, airBaltic will launch its highest-ever number of new routes – a total of 20 new routes from all of its bases in the Baltics and Finland. That being said, we are glad to extend our partnership with APG Network for further support in our new markets. We are looking forward to this collaboration being extended even further ahead of airBaltic’s ongoing network growth.”

“I am delighted to see that, following years of successful partnership in several markets, airBaltic continues to have confidence in APG and its services. I am confident that APG will deliver high quality service in Turkey, Moldova and Romania and give airBaltic full support for the successful launch of the new routes to Istanbul and Bucharest” added Sandrine de Saint Sauveur, APG CEO.

ABOUT AIRBALTIC:
www.airBaltic.com

airBaltic (Air Baltic Corporation AS) connects the Baltic region with over 70 destinations in Europe, the Middle East, and the CIS. Over the last 27 years, airBaltic has developed as a strong, profitable, and internationally respected airline, which employs more than 2200 employees. airBaltic is by far the best-known international brand in Latvia and responsible for more than 2.5% of the Latvian GDP. airBaltic operates 39 Airbus A220-300 aircraft. airBaltic has received numerous international awards for excellence and innovative services. Skytrax has awarded Latvian airline airBaltic a five–star COVID-19 safety rating and the Best Airline in Eastern Europe in 2022. In addition, airBaltic is one of the Top twenty airlines for COVID-19 compliance by the safety, product, and COVID-19 rating agency Airlineratings.com. In 2018 and 2019 airBaltic received the ATW Airline Industry Achievement Award as the Market Leader of the Year. In addition, in 2019 airBaltic received Sector Leadership Award by Airline Business. airBaltic is a joint stock company that was established in 1995. Its primary shareholder is the Latvian state, which holds 97.96% of the stock, while the rest of the shareholders hold 2.04%.

CYPRUS AIRWAYS extends its partnership with APG and appoints APG as its GSA in Greece

All, news

Cyprus Airways, the National flag carrier of Cyprus, has chosen APG Hellas SA as its General Sales Agent (GSA) in Greece. The new partnership starts from the 1st of January 2023 and will further develop Cyprus Airways’ business activities in Greece. APG Hellas will provide sales development activities, wide ranging marketing support, as well as reservation and ticketing services.

Cyprus Airways is strategically positioned to connect Europe with Asia, the Middle East and Africa. Its international network currently includes Athens, Tel Aviv, Beirut, Rome, Paris, Yerevan, and several popular destinations in Greece during the summer season.

As part of its international expansion, Cyprus Airways launched the new route from Larnaca to Paris on 21 December 2022, with two flights per week. The route will be operated with an Airbus A320 aircraft offering 180 seats.

For the summer of 2023, Cyprus Airways will add five new destinations to its network, Milan, Zurich,Prague, Basel and Cairo.

More specifically, next year the airline will be resuming twice weekly flights to Prague, Zurich and Cairo and will, for the first time, operate a twice weekly service to Basel. Milan Bergamo will also be serviced twice a week with a possibility to increase the operation to a three times a week service.

Paris and Rome will remain in operation through summer alongside Santorini (twice per week), Skiathos (twice per week) and Preveza (twice per week). Crete and Rhodes will be serviced with three-time weekly flights, whilst Thessaloniki will be serviced daily. Beirut will reclaim its daily service while operations to Tel-Aviv will increase to up to 10 flights per week. Services to Yerevan, Armenia are set to increase to up to four weekly flights whilst Athens will be serviced with up to three daily flights.

Konstantinos Tsovilis, CEO of APG Hellas SA said: “We are delighted to announce our new cooperation with Cyprus Airways in Greece and to be partner of the airline’s exciting strategic growth. With tourism in Cyprus continuing to bounce back post-pandemic, there are great opportunities to develop Cyprus Airways’ long-term commercial support and partnership with the Greek market. Cyprus is one of the most popular destinations for Greeks, we will continue to develop Cyprus Airways presence in the Greek market and to increase the number of passengers visiting Cyprus every year.”

Paul Sies, CEO of Cyprus Airways said: “We are confident that APG will upgrade the service of Cyprus Airways customers all over Greece with high professionalism.” He adds, “Their extensive success in the industry and long-time experience and expertise will help us better service this market with the necessary local talent that guarantees global class know-how.”

PASSENGER CONTACT:
Passengers can be informed and book their tickets through APG Hellas ( Greece ) at the call center: + 0030 210 3274 555, or through their travel agent, or through the airline’s official website cyprusairways.com

ABOUT CYPRUS AIRWAYS:
www.cyprusairways.com
Cyprus Airways operates flights to Europe and the Middle-East with a team of over 100 passionate people based at Larnaca International Airport. All Cyprus Airways flights operate on Airbus A320 aircraft with a capacity of 180 Economy Class seats.

In July 2018, Cyprus Airways has successfully passed the International Air Transport Association (IATA) Operational Safety Audit (IOSA), one of the highest standards in the world for airline operational safety.

In October 2018, the company became a member of the International Air Transport Association (IATA).

In April 2021, Cyprus Airways was acquired by the SJC Group, a Maltese group with operations across Africa and the Middle East, incorporating a number of different activities including helicopter commercial flight operations and maintenance from dedicated hangars within Malta International Airport. The SJC Group maintains a fleet of private aircraft to provide emergency services in remote parts of the world. The company is also a leading provider of fire, safety, and security services. The company’s long-term goal is to contribute in the increase of tourism in Cyprus, while at the same time broadening the horizon for local travellers.
